#f28e9f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f28e9f is composed of 94.9% red, 55.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 34.3%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 349.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 75.3%. #f28e9f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e51d3f.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#f28e9f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f28e9f has RGB values of R:242, G:142,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.34,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15896223.

Shades and Tints of #f28e9f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0103 is the darkest color, while #fef8f9 is the lightest one.
